Chinese Studies (with Year Abroad) BA Hons
This is multidisciplinary degree will develop advanced knowledge and understanding of Chinese language and culture.
You will study a core language module in each of your three years spent in Durham.

Required subjects for Chinese Studies (with Year Abroad) BA Hons at Durham University
We look for aptitude in language study but there is no requirement for an A Level foreign language or equivalent qualification.
Students taking the History route must have an A in A Level History or equivalent qualification.
Specific subjects excluded for entry:
General Studies and Critical Thinking.
Information:
Applicants taking Science A-levels that include a practical component will be required to take and pass this as a condition of entry. This refers only to English A Levels.
